Implicit/explicit memory dissociation in Alzheimer's disease: the consequence of inappropriate processing?
Sylvie Willems1, Eric Salmon, Martial Van der Linden
1Department of Cognitive Sciences, University of Liège. sylvie.willems@ulg.ac.be
Alzheimer's disease (AD) patients show intact perceptual priming but impaired recognition. This study found that encouraging holistic processing during recognition tasks significantly improved AD patients' performance, suggesting strategy influences fluency use.

Background:
- Dual-process theories suggest perceptual fluency underlies recognition and priming.
- The priming-without-recognition dissociation in Alzheimer's disease (AD) challenges this, showing intact priming with impaired recognition.
- This dissociation implies familiarity and perceptual priming may be distinct processes.
Purpose of the Study:
- To investigate if processing strategies explain the priming-without-recognition dissociation in AD patients.
- To determine if AD patients' use of perceptual fluency is strategy-dependent.
Main Methods:
- Replicated the priming-without-recognition effect in 16 AD patients with intact exposure effects but null recognition.
- Manipulated processing strategies (holistic vs. analytic) during recognition and priming tasks.
- Compared performance of AD patients and healthy controls under different processing conditions.
Main Results:
- Confirmed the priming-without-recognition effect in the studied AD cohort.
- Inducing a holistic processing strategy during recognition testing significantly improved AD patients' recognition performance.
- Analytic processing decreased performance in both priming and recognition tasks for AD patients.
Conclusions:
- The use of perceptual fluency in priming and recognition by AD patients is contingent on their processing approach.
- Processing strategy choice may be influenced by the perceived task difficulty in AD.
- Findings suggest cognitive strategies can modulate memory performance in Alzheimer's disease.
